假设已经创建了数据库CBVR(可通过Oracle的DBCA可视化工具创建,在命令行中输入dbca)

系统的用户名(system)和密码已知,在cmd中输入sqlplus,登录。


1.创建表空间

create tablespace newnupt datafile 'c:\database\newnupt.dbf' size 200M;

其中,

a. newnupt是表空间的名称

b. 'c:\database\newnupt.dbf' 表示数据库文件存放的位置

c. 200M指表空间的大小

2.创建用户

 create user nupt identified by 111111 default tablespace newnupt;

 用户名:nupt

 密码:111111

 表空间:newnupt

3.授权

grant connect,resource to nupt;

grant dba to nupt;

4.PL/SQL客户端登录

Username: nupt

Password: 111111

Database: ip:1521/CBVR


Connect as:Normal

5.然后就能登录....

----------------------------------------------------------------------------------------------

数据库的导出:

exp 用户名/密码@IP地址:端口号(1521)/数据库名称 file=c://xxx.dmp

数据库的导入

imp 用户名/密码@IP地址:端口号(1521)/数据库名称 file=c://xxx.dmp fromuser 用户名1 touser 用户名2

----------------------------------------------------------------------------------------------

MyEclipse与Oracle数据库的连接,为项目添加Hibernate依赖,以及Hibernate的逆向工程(根据数据库表格来自动生成实体类和对应的.xml配置文件)

1.数据库连接配置举例

Oracle创建表空间和用户-导入导出_用户名

2.为项目添加Hibernate兼容包

Oracle创建表空间和用户-导入导出_数据库_02


Oracle创建表空间和用户-导入导出_用户名_03

Oracle创建表空间和用户-导入导出_用户名_04

Oracle创建表空间和用户-导入导出_用户名_05

3.逆向配置示例

Oracle创建表空间和用户-导入导出_数据库_06

在windows上cmd中输入services.msc,可以看到Oracle运行的服务

Oracle创建表空间和用户-导入导出_表空间_07